| Function | Venom protein that mimics the incretin hormone glucagon-like peptide 1 (GLP-1). It stimulates insulin synthesis and secretion; protects against beta-cell apoptosis in response to different insults; and promotes beta-cell proliferation It also promotes satiety; reduces food intake; reduces fat deposition; reduces body weight and inhibits gastric emptying. Interacts with GLP-1 receptor (GLP1R). Induces hypotension that is mediated by relaxation of cardiac smooth muscle. |
